ASEAN SHOP: Southeast Asia’s Premier Retail and Food Service Expo

ASEAN SHOP has emerged as one of the leading trade fairs in Southeast Asia, providing a specialized platform for retail, food service, and automated sales solutions. Organized by Guangdong Grandeur International Exhibition Group Co., Ltd., the expo represents a strategic convergence of two well-established events – VEND ASEAN and FNB ASEAN – bringing their combined expertise into a single, forward-looking trade fair. With this new concept, ASEAN SHOP offers a clear and comprehensive overview of innovations, technologies, and market-specific solutions tailored to the dynamic Southeast Asian retail landscape.

Held annually in the autumn, ASEAN SHOP attracts industry professionals, business owners, and technology providers from across the region. Its scope covers a broad range of retail and food service solutions, emphasizing the growing role of digitization, automation, and flexibility in modern brick-and-mortar operations.

Palmex Malaysia

十一月 17, 2026 - 十一月 18, 2026

Palmex Malaysia is a leading trade fair for the palm oil industry in Asia, widely recognized for its strong focus on innovation, efficiency, and sustainable development. Held annually at the Kuala Lumpur Convention Centre (KLCC), this event has become a central gathering point for professionals involved in palm oil extraction, processing, and related technologies. Over time, it has grown into a highly specialized platform where industry leaders, engineers, and decision-makers come together to explore the future of one of the world’s most important agricultural sectors.

Located in Kuala Lumpur, a vibrant economic hub, the event benefits from its strategic position within one of the largest palm oil-producing regions globally. This geographic relevance enhances the fair’s impact, making it not just an exhibition but a meaningful driver of industry progress.

A specialized platform for palm oil technologies and innovation

The name Palmex, derived from “Palm Oil Expo,” clearly reflects the core mission of the event. It is dedicated to showcasing advanced technologies and solutions that improve every stage of palm oil production. From plantation management to refining and waste treatment, the exhibition provides a comprehensive overview of the industry.

Palmex Malaysia stands out for its practical orientation. Rather than focusing only on theoretical concepts, it emphasizes real-world applications that can be implemented directly in production environments. This makes the event especially valuable for companies seeking to improve efficiency, reduce costs, and meet environmental standards.

Key technologies and solutions on display

The exhibition covers a broad spectrum of products and services that support the palm oil value chain:

Technologies for palm oil extraction and refining
Agricultural machinery for plantation management
Agrochemicals, fertilizers, and crop protection solutions
Biomass processing and energy recovery systems
Sustainable technologies for waste and water management

This diversity highlights how the industry is evolving into a more integrated and environmentally conscious sector, where innovation plays a central role.
